What Do Same-Day Dental Implants Involve and How Do They Work?
Same-day dental implants provide a groundbreaking solution for individuals looking for immediate tooth replacement. Unlike conventional implants that require multiple visits over many months, same-day implants streamline the process, enabling patients to obtain a permanent prosthetic in a single appointment. This advanced procedure typically includes the extraction of a damaged tooth, the placement of a titanium post into the jawbone, and the instant attachment of a temporary crown.
The methodology incorporates state-of-the-art imaging technology and precise coordination to confirm correct positioning and steadiness. When the implant becomes fixed, the temporary restoration confers visual appeal while the underlying implant combines with the bone tissue. This integration, referred to as osseointegration, is essential for sustained success. Patients benefit from shortened waiting periods and immediate availability, making same-day dental implants an attractive solution for those in need of rapid replacement answers.

Bone Density Testing Required
Determining skeletal thickness is an essential step in establishing if a patient is an suitable prospect for same-day dental implants. Sufficient bone density is crucial, as it delivers the required foundation for the prosthetic devices. Dental professionals often utilize imaging techniques, such as X-rays or 3D scans, to evaluate the density and volume of the jawbone. If skeletal thickness is inadequate, individuals may require bone grafting procedures before implant placement. This evaluation helps in identifying possible issues but also guarantees the firmness and durability of the prosthetic devices. In conclusion, a comprehensive skeletal evaluation aids dental professionals in determining appropriate options, tailoring treatment plans, and enhancing overall patient outcomes in the domain of same-day dental implant procedures.
Overall Health Considerations Important
Overall health plays an essential role in evaluating candidacy for same-day dental implants. Factors such as chronic illnesses, autoimmune disorders, and uncontrolled diabetes can impact the healing process and overall success of the implants. Additionally, patients with heart conditions or those who smoke may face increased risks during and after the procedure. A thorough medical history review is essential, as it helps dental professionals identify potential complications. Patients should also consider their oral hygiene practices, as good dental care is critical for implant longevity. Ultimately, a detailed assessment guarantees that candidates are not only physically prepared but also informed about the implications of the procedure, leading to ideal outcomes for those seeking this modern dental solution.

Getting Ready What Happens During Your Implant Procedure
During the implant surgery, patients can anticipate a precisely executed process intended to rebuilding their smiles successfully. Initially, the dentist will conduct a thorough examination, with imaging, to establish the optimal positioning of the implant. Following this assessment, numbing medication is applied to guarantee comfort throughout the procedure.
The dental professional then proceeds with the placement of the implant into the jaw, a process that typically takes about an hour. Once the implant is firmly placed, a provisional crown may be attached, enabling the patient to leave the office with a working tooth.
Throughout the intervention, the dental team remains alert, supervising the patient's comfort and resolving any questions. Post-procedure instructions will be supplied, guiding the patient on care and recovery. Overall, patients can expect a streamlined interaction designed to deliver immediate results and enhance their dental health.

Aftercare for Same-Day Tooth Implants
After obtaining same-day dental implants, proper aftercare is necessary for optimal healing and long-term success. Patients are advised to adhere to particular instructions to ensure the best recovery. At first, it is important to control any pain with prescribed pain medications discover the facts and to apply ice packs to reduce swelling. Gentle cuisine should be prioritized during the early recovery period to avoid putting pressure on the implants.
Maintaining mouth health is essential; patients should gently brush and rinse their mouths as recommended by their dentist. Avoiding smoking and drinking alcohol is also critical, as these substances can obstruct the healing process. Regular follow-up appointments will allow for monitoring the implant's integration with the jawbone.
Finally, sticking to dietary restrictions and steering clear of intense exercise for a brief time will aid in a faster healing process. By following these aftercare instructions, patients can maximize the durability and success rate of their same-day dental implants.

Popular Inquiries Posed
How long-lasting Are Same-Day Dental Implants?
Same-day dental implants tend to last between 10 to 15 years, relying on personal dental maintenance, lifestyle factors, and the excellence of the implant. Consistent dental appointments and maintenance can extend their longevity and potency.
Are same-day implants pricier than conventional implants?
Same-day implants typically are more expensive than traditional implants due to the cutting-edge equipment and instant installation involved. Patients should consider the advantages and ease alongside the increased cost when choosing.
Can I Eat Normally Right After the Treatment?
Patients are generally advised to steer clear of hard or chewy foods right after the procedure. Soft foods are suggested for the initial days to guarantee proper healing and comfort while the implants fuse to the jawbone.
What Types of Anesthesia Are Applied During the Procedure?
Throughout the procedure, dentists generally apply local numbing agents to numb the region. In certain situations, sedative choices like nitrous oxide or intravenous sedation may also be provided to allow patients stay at ease and calm throughout.
What frequency ought I reach out to My Dentist After treatment?
After the treatment, individuals must book follow-up appointments with their dentist generally within a week, then every few months for the first year. Routine check-ups guarantee proper recuperation and implant bonding into the jawbone.
